    Common Plumbing Issues That Don’t Get Addressed 

    WashimBy WashimFebruary 12, 2025No Comments4 Mins Read31 Views

    Plumbing is a complex and sophisticated system that is bound to experience issues from time to time. This is why it is advisable to get regular plumbing inspections done to avoid expensive repairs down the line. 

    There are many warning signs that you should look out for such as rattling noises coming from your pipes. If you notice a sudden increase in your water bill, it may be a sign of a plumbing issue. 

    1. Clogged Drains 

    If there’s one issue that can quickly spiral out of control and cause major damage to your home, it’s clogged drains. Whether from soap scum, hair, or kitchen grease, clogged drains prevent plumbing water from flowing through pipes and into fixtures. This can lead to flooding, overflows, and leaks. Simple clogs are often easily fixed with a plunger or plumber’s snake, but serious problems may require a professional. 

    Clogged drains are more common in bathrooms, where dirt, skin flakes, and hair bind with soap scum to form gunk that impedes water flow. However, they can also happen in kitchen sinks and toilets, as well as outside drain lines. Thankfully, there are clues that can help you spot a clog before it becomes a nightmare. Standing water is a clear indicator, as are unpleasant odors or gurgling noises. Because plumbing systems are gravity-based, clogs will start with the lowest drain or fixture and work their way up. 

    1. Leaky Pipes 

    Every homeowner will experience plumbing issues at some point. But, understanding these problems and how to address them can help homeowners save time and money. 

    While modern plumbing systems are a huge advancement in home safety and convenience, they can still suffer from everyday wear and tear. From clogged drains to pipe leaks, these issues can lead to costly repairs. But, there are things you can do to prevent them from happening in the first place. 

    Leaky pipes can cause serious water damage to your home and should be fixed immediately. Luckily, there are several signs you can watch out for to detect leaky pipes before they get worse. 

    Look for damp areas on your floor, walls, or ceiling. If you notice this, it’s a good idea to call a plumber for inspection. This is because the leak may be causing structural damage to your home or allowing harmful gases like sewage to enter. Leaky pipes should be repaired as soon as possible to avoid expensive repair bills. 

    1. Burst Pipes 

    Unexpected pipe bursts can cause significant water damage in your home.

    Fortunately, there are some warning signs you can watch out for that can help you to spot and address them in time. These include water stains on walls and ceilings, inexplicable drops in water pressure, and weird noises coming from your pipes. 

    Physical damage to your pipes can also increase the risk of bursting. This includes accidents such as a heavy object falling on them or construction work that damages the pipes underneath. Over time, older pipes can lose their structural integrity and become more prone to bursts. 

    You can check for broken pipes by monitoring your water meter. An unexplained increase in your water consumption can indicate that there is a leak or a burst pipe somewhere in your house. Also, listen for clanking, rattling or hissing sounds when you turn on your faucets. These are caused by water hammer that may lead to ruptured pipes. 

    1. Frozen Pipes 

    Frozen pipes can lead to extensive water damage if left untreated. This is especially true for pipes that are exposed to frigid temperatures and/or run along exterior walls or in cold crawl spaces in older homes. Symptoms of frozen pipes include no water or a slow trickle coming out of faucets, whistling and banging sounds from toilets and sinks, and dampness or rings on drywall and ceilings. 

    If you suspect a pipe is frozen, turn off your home’s water supply and shut off the power to the affected area. Next, apply heat to the frozen area using a heating pad or hairdryer (never use a torch or anything flammable). It may help to wrap the frozen section of pipe in a towel soaked in hot water. Once the frozen ice melts, you can turn on your faucet and check for signs of leaks or further damage to your home. A licensed plumber can help you prevent frozen pipes in the future by insulating them and addressing any other issues that could contribute to their freezing.
